The Webmaster's Lexicon: X

XHTML Extensible HyperText Markup Language (XHTML) is a reformulation of HTML 4.0 as an application of XML 1.0. XHTML 1.0 specifies three DTDs that correspond to the HTML 4.0 DTDs, along with an XML namespace which is identified by a unique URI. XHTML 1.0 is promised to be the basis for a family of future document types which extend and subset HTML.
XML Extensible Markup Language (XML) is an ISO compliant subset of SGML A metalanguage, it allows for custom tags to be processed. Custom tags will enable the definition, transmission and interpretation of data structures between organizations.
XSL (Extensible Style Language) (XSL) is a stylesheet language designed for the Web community. It provides functionality beyond CSS (e.g. element reordering). XSL will be used where more powerful formatting capabilities are required or for formatting highly structured information such as XML structured data or XML documents that contain structrued data.
